UWI honours first vice-chancellor

by UWI
“W. ARTHUR LEWIS DAY” IS CARDED FOR JAN. 23 AMID 70TH ANNIVERSARY CELEBRATIONS.

Tomorrow, Tuesday, Jan. 23, will be observed as “W. Arthur Lewis Day” at The University of the West Indies.

As part of UWI’s 70th celebrations, the Sir Arthur Lewis Institute of Social and Economic Studies (SALISES) will commemorate the work of Sir Arthur Lewis, the University’s first Vice-Chancellor, and celebrate 70 years of research contributions to economic policy and process in the Caribbean.

W. Arthur Lewis Day will see a series of events hosted across the University’s Cave Hill, Mona and St. Augustine campuses, including forums to discuss the current relevance of Lewis’ work amid the economic challenges facing the region.
